Saint Patrick's Legend
Patrick was created in a tiny village, but his life took a dramatic turn when he Patrickstash was taken by ruthless pirates and shipped to Ireland as a slave. During his long captivity, Patrick was touched by the beauty of the Irish nature. He dedicated his time contemplating with God and eventually found his way to freedom.
After his return to Britain, Patrick underwent a transformative religious calling. He felt a deep need to return Ireland and preach the message of Christianity. Patrick's mission was laden with challenges, but he successfully met them all with dedication.
His arrival in Ireland was greeted by both acceptance. He dedicated himself converting the Irish people to Christianity, performing miracles, and recording their rich traditions.
Patrick's legacy is an example of faith, courage, and compassion. He holds a place in the hearts of the Irish people as a beloved figure. His story continues to inspire generations with its message of hope, redemption, and the power of good.
